On this day in 1899, ground was broken for Boston's Symphony Hall. From the day it was completed a year-and-a-half later, the building would be considered one of finest concert halls in the world.
Neil Diamond to perform with Pops
Locals may soon hear "Sweet Caroline" in a venue other than Fenway Park. Neil Diamond, the pop singer whose hit "Sweet Caroline" has become a sort of unofficial anthem of Red Sox home games, will join Keith Lockhart and the Boston Pops for this year's free Fourth of July concert on the Esplanade, said Liberty Mutual , the Boston insurance company ...

Cellist Maya Beiser loves Led Zeppelin
Maya Beiser, who plays with the Boston Pops next week, says she represents a generation of classical musicians ''embracing a much larger palette of musical styles.'' Though no category of performers has a monopoly on adventurousness, cellists seem to be an especially daring lot.
